Infants with apnea and gestational age >30.36 weeks, body weight at initiation of aminophylline treatment above 1.69 kg, and birth weight >1.48 kg are suitable for treatment with aminophylline. Monitoring of serum theophylline concentration should be implemented in the absence of clinical response or in case of suspected adverse reactions.
